2013-10-29* add RUBY_TYPED_FREE_IMMEDIATELY to data types which only useko1
safe functions during garbage collection such as xfree(). On default, T_DATA objects are freed at same points as fianlizers. This approach protects issues such as reported by [ruby-dev:35578]. However, freeing T_DATA objects immediately helps heap usage. Most of T_DATA (in other words, most of dfree functions) are safe.
